Area contextNeighborhood Overview – Sweden Town Park (Brockport, NY)
Sweden Town Park is situated in the town of Sweden, just south of the historic village of Brockport in western New York. The park is easily accessible via Redman Road, which connects to NY-19, a key north-south artery. For those arriving from the New York State Thruway (I-90), take Exit 47 and head north on NY-19. The nearest major airport is the Greater Rochester International Airport (ROC), approximately a 30-40 minute drive east, depending on traffic. Visitors arriving by air will typically rent a car or use a ride-share service, as public transit options directly to the park are limited. Traffic can be moderate on Redman Road and NY-19, especially during peak event times or weekend afternoons. Planning your arrival for 15-20 minutes before your scheduled game or event is advisable to account for parking and walk-throughs.
Lodging contextWhere to Stay Near Sweden Town Park
The primary lodging options for visitors to Sweden Town Park are concentrated in the nearby village of Brockport, about a 5-10 minute drive away, and the surrounding rural areas. While there are no hotels directly adjacent to the park, Brockport offers a selection of inns and motels, serving as the most convenient base for teams and families. For more extensive hotel choices, guests can drive about 20-30 minutes east to Rochester, which has a wide array of accommodations. Many families opt to stay in Brockport for its proximity and local charm, while teams might seek out larger hotels in Rochester for more amenities or group bookings. Booking accommodations well in advance is highly recommended, especially during the spring and summer sports seasons, as local availability can fill up quickly due to tournaments and league play.

On siteHarold L. Gleason Golf Course
Adjacent to Sweden Town Park, the Harold L. Gleason Golf Course offers a well-regarded 18-hole public golfing experience. It features a variety of challenging holes set amidst rolling terrain and mature trees, providing a picturesque backdrop for a round of golf. The course is known for its friendly atmosphere and is a popular spot for local golfers and visitors alike. Booking tee times in advance is recommended, especially on weekends, to secure your preferred slot and enjoy a leisurely game before or after a day of sports.

Brockport Village Historic District
Stroll through the charming historic downtown area of Brockport, situated along the picturesque Erie Canal. This district features well-preserved 19th-century architecture, boutique shops, art galleries, and a variety of eateries. It’s a great place to experience local culture, find unique souvenirs, or enjoy a leisurely walk with views of the canal. The village also hosts various community events throughout the year, adding to its vibrant atmosphere. Its proximity makes it an easy destination for a post-game outing or a family exploration.

Weather & Seasons at Sweden Town Park
- Winter: Winter in this region brings cold temperatures, with average highs in the 30s Fahrenheit. Snowfall is common, often blanketing the landscape. Outdoor sports activity at the park is minimal to nonexistent during these months. Visitors should pack heavy coats, insulated layers, hats, and gloves for any travel.
- Spring & early summer: Spring temperatures gradually warm from cool to mild, typically ranging from the 40s to 60s Fahrenheit. Rain showers are frequent, and wind can still be a factor. Early summer is pleasant, with highs often in the 70s. Layers are recommended for variable conditions, and waterproof outerwear is advisable.
- Mid-summer: Mid-summer brings the warmest weather, with average highs in the upper 70s and 80s Fahrenheit, often accompanied by humidity. Heat advisories are possible. Lightweight, breathable clothing is essential. Sunscreen, hats, and sunglasses are highly recommended for all outdoor activities at the park.
- Fall season: Fall offers crisp air and comfortably cool temperatures, generally ranging from the 50s to 70s Fahrenheit. The leaves change, creating beautiful scenery. Evenings can become chilly, so bringing a light jacket or sweater is wise. This season is prime for comfortable outdoor sports events.
- Rain & snow: Rain is possible in any season, though more prevalent in spring and fall. Snow typically falls from late November through March. During wet weather, fields may become muddy. During winter, snow can make the park inaccessible for sports. Be sure to check forecasts and have appropriate gear for wet or cold conditions.
